About Achille
Achille is a Achille, Oklahoma school district serving 2 schools. The district educates 300 students with a student-teacher ratio of 13.6:1. The district invests $13,961 per student annually.
With an average rating of 8.3/10, Achille is among the strongest-performing districts in the state.
The highest-rated school in the district is Achille ES, which has a composite score of 8.7/10.
In standardized testing, Achille students show an average math proficiency of 26.8% and ELA proficiency of 32.6%.
The district includes 1 elementary school , and 1 high school.
